If I understand GMG's theory, on a "Long" signal as was triggered over the weekend for this morning, the better way to play this is to buy a VXX Call, so I'm going to try trading today's signal on paper in that way:
Buy 9/23 $37.50 Call and,
Sell 9/23 $41.00 Call for risk reversal.

Earlier this morning this trade cost me 99 cents. (note: I missed the open when this probably would have been $0.90, but mid-morning would have been ideal as this trade bottomed out at $0.67)

Since Kevin has a 10 day max holding period, it probably would have been more correct to play this with a 9/30 target, but the signals have been coming fast on this system, so this was a personal preference call. Not sure why Kevin went with an October target on his paper trade.

Conversely, if this had been a "Short" signal, do I understand that the play would have been to sell an in the money call while buying an at the money call for risk reversal purposes? For example, if today's signal had been to short Vix, the play might have been to:
Sell 9/23 $35.00 VXX Call and
Buy 9/23 $38.00 VXX Call?
Collecting about $1.75 premium while waiting for the move down?

The only futures available to trade were the Sep 21 or the Oct 19, so the one expiring on Wednesday was not really a good choice. These are futures not options. Besides, the ^VIX is built off of the futures so this should be a good surrogate for the index - not sure if options really are even though they might be a good way to trade the signals.
